Transaction 15399fcd5d53a8d49f15b199eeffdf9a0818a838387507273f69359a344de3f0
1 Input
1 Output
-
15399fcd5d53a8d49f15b199eeffdf9a0818a838387507273f69359a344de3f0:0
- value
- 255389
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fa8588516c3b7ff26543c1183c2e1fccf583771
- address
- bc1q87593pgkcwml7fj58sgc8shpln84sdm336aeza